Pydantic Logfire Enables Zero-Code Migration from Braintrust
samuelcolvin · x · 2026-08-06
Pydantic Logfire now speaks Braintrust, allowing developers to switch their existing evaluation workflows seamlessly by changing just two environment variables, with zero code changes required.
The integration currently supports Python and TypeScript Eval runs, including local data, tasks, and scorers. Once configured, future runs are directed to Logfire, and users can easily revert to Braintrust at any time by restoring their previous settings.
